Abstract
A semiconductor temperature compensation circuit for an electronic timepiece is provided. The temperature compensation circuit is characterized by a temperature detection circuit comprised of MOS transistors, at least two of which have distinct conductive coefficients for producing signals representative of variations in ambient temperature and a temperature signal converting means including MOS transistors for converting the temperature dependent signal into a temperature compensation value for effecting timing rate adjustment in an electronic timepiece. The temperature detection circuit and the temperature signal converter circuit are both formed of elements that can be monolithically integrated into the same substrate.
